Norfolk Southern To Begin New Bridge Install This Week
If you have been driving on east Hwy 25-70, you have been seeing those big cranes down by the Pigeon River. The Norfolk Southern Railroad is coninuing their work to replace the railroad trestle that was destroyed by the September 27 flood. This week will mark a huge step in restoring that railroad. The new railroad bridge is set to be installed this week. Norfolk Southern says they are on track to meet their goal of having the railroad back open between Grovestone, North Carolina and Newport by the end of this month. This railroad line runs from Salisbury, NC to Morristown. Multiple areas of that track were washed out by the flood. Norfolk Southern says their engineers removed over 15,000 trees from the track after the flood.
